Background
Wind energy is a kind of available energy provided to human beings by the work done by the air flow, and belongs to renewable energy sources. Solar energy in the narrow sense refers to the direct conversion of solar radiation energy into photothermal, photoelectric and photochemical energy. Nuclear energy (also called atomic energy) is the energy released when the nuclear structure changes. Geothermal energy is mostly renewable heat energy from deep in the earth, resulting from the decay of the earth's molten magma and radioactive materials. Biomass refers to various organisms produced by photosynthesis using the atmosphere, water, land, and the like, and energy generated during the activity of living biomass that can grow is called biomass energy. Ocean energy refers to renewable energy attached to sea water, which receives and stores energy in the form of tides, waves, temperature differences, salinity gradients, ocean currents, etc. through various physical processes.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
As shown in fig. 1-4, a new energy introduction display device for a new energy automobile exhibition hall comprises:
the real-time capturing module is used for capturing the image motion of the participant in real time and transmitting a signal to the image motion recognition module, and comprises a camera 5;
an image motion recognition module for analyzing, processing and recognizing the collected motion in real time so as to obtain coordinate data of the participant when participating in interaction, and transmitting the signal of the real-time capture module to the multimedia content module, the image motion recognition module comprising: a host computer 7 with a processor, video and audio output interfaces and image action processing software;
the multimedia content module is used for comparing the interactive coordinate data of the participants with the coordinate information in the content and lotus root, so that the participants can wave hands to shoot and push bubbles in the picture, and multimedia interaction is realized, and the multimedia content module comprises a background wall 1, a screen 3 and a sound box 6; a bracket 4 is arranged on the background wall 1, the bracket 4 is a rectangular hollow frame structure formed by welding and connecting angle steels, and a closing-up panel 2 is fixedly connected outside the bracket 4; the closing-in panel 2 is a rectangular hollow structure formed by acrylic plates, the closing-in panel 2 wraps the support 4, access doors are arranged on two sides of the closing-in panel 2, a rectangular opening is formed in the upper half part of the front side of the closing-in panel 2, and a camera shooting hole is formed below the middle of the rectangular opening; a screen 3 is arranged in an opening of the closing-in panel 2, and a camera 5 is arranged in a camera hole; a neon lamp tube is arranged on the background wall above the closing-in panel 2 and extends to the new energy automobile model along the wall surface; the support 4 is internally provided with a sound box 6 and a computer host 7, and the screen 3, the camera 5, the sound box 6 and the computer host 7 are connected with a power supply through a circuit.
During specific implementation, the support 4 and the closing-in panel 2 are both provided with reserved pipeline holes, and the thickness of the inner cavity space between the closing-in panel 2 and the background wall 1 is not less than 1000 mm.
In specific implementation, a clear area not less than 8 square meters is reserved in front of the closing-in panel 2 opposite to the front of the camera shooting hole.
When the device is actually used, the camera 5 captures the image motion of the participant in real time; the image action recognition module analyzes, processes and recognizes the collected action in real time, so as to obtain coordinate data of the participant when participating in interaction; the multimedia content module can compare the interactive coordinate data of the participants with the coordinate information in the content and carry out lotus root, so that the participants can wave hands to shoot and push bubbles in the picture, and multimedia interaction is realized.
In the standby state, the screen 3 plays standby pictures under the control of the host computer 7, namely, a plurality of pictures written with bubbles of wind energy, solar energy, nuclear energy, geothermal energy, biomass energy and ocean energy and floating upwards respectively; when the camera 5 captures a portrait and slides across bubbles in a recognition area by hands, the image action processing software of the computer host 7 processes the portrait and feeds the portrait back to the picture of the screen 3, the bubbles on the picture are broken and enter an energy collector above the picture, and a progress bar beside the bubble starts to be gradually filled; when the progress bar is fully filled, the progress bar starts to gradually return to a zero filling picture, and the neon lamp tube on the background wall 1 is started under the joint control of the host computer 7, and the neon lamp tube lights out from the end of the closing-in panel to the automobile model section by section to form horse-race flicker; when the progress bar returns to the zero filling picture, returning to the standby state; the standby state is automatically restored for 30s in the unmanned operation state.
